In-Game Purchases and Cosmetic Expenses

The largest chunk of gaming costs typically comes from in-game purchases. These include cosmetic items like character skins, weapon designs, emotes, and battle passes that offer seasonal content. While purely cosmetic items don’t affect gameplay mechanics, they significantly impact your gaming budget.

Battle passes represent a monthly or seasonal investment, usually costing between 500 to 2000 pesos depending on the platform and game title. These passes unlock progression tracks with exclusive rewards as you complete challenges.
